Wahluke School District 73 is a public school district in Washington. They
serve 2,464 students across 6
schools, and its teachers have
had 69 projects funded on Ðǿմ«Ã½.

Wahluke School District 73 had a total revenue of
$33.2 million
in the 2016-17 school year.
10.4% came from local sources,
76.9% from state sources, and
12.7% from federal sources.
